ORDINANCE NO. 466
AN ORDINANCE AMENDING AND CHANGING ZONING ORDINANCE NO. 390 OF THE CITY OF REXBURG, TO
PROVIDE THAT THE HEREINAFTER DESCRIBED REAL PROPERTY SITUATED IN BLOCK 49 OF THE ORIGINAL
REXBURG TOWNSITE, IN THE CITY OF REXBURG, MADISON COUNTY, IDAHO, BE PLACED IN "C" COMMERCIAL
DISTRICT RATHER THAN "A" RESIDENTIAL DISTRICT.
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E MAYOR AND C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F REXBURG IDAHO:
SECTION I. That Section 2 of Ordinance No. 390 of the City of Rexburg, Idaho, be amended to read, as follows:
"That portion of Lot 1, Block 49, of the original Rexburg Townsite in the City of Rexburg, Madison County, State of Idaho,
and more particularly described as follows:
Commencing at the Northeast corner of Lot. No. 1, Block 49 of the original Rexburg townsite in.
the City of Rexburg, Madison County, Idaho, as per the recorded plat thereof; and running thence
West 143.5 feet; thence South 82.5 feet; thence East 143.5 feet; thence North 82.5 feet to the point
of beginning.
be, and the same is hereby placed in "C" Commercial District, rather than "A" Residential District for the purpose only of constructing
a professional office building thereon to be used and occupied as professional offices only.
PASSED BY THE CITY COUNCIL this 21st day of June, 1967.
